减振器用活塞组件
本技术属于减振器部件
,具体涉及一种减振器用活塞组件。
技术介绍
活塞组件是减振器中必不可少的部分,传统技术的活塞组件虽然可以满足市场的需求,但是其油气噪声较大,而且使用可靠性较为有限,故而适用性和实用性受到限制。
技术实现思路
本技术的目的是提供一种结构设置合理且使用稳定性好的减振器用活塞组件。实现本技术目的的技术方案是一种减振器用活塞组件,包括活塞,在所述活塞上设有内流通阀孔和外流通阀孔,还包括间隔套,在所述活塞的顶部设有流通阀限位垫,在所述活塞的顶面设有流通阀阀片,在所述流通阀限位垫与所述流通阀阀片的顶面之间设有流通阀弹簧片,所述间隔套的内表面与活塞的内表面处于同一面上,在所述间隔套的外侧面固定有复原阀弹簧座,在所述复原阀弹簧座的顶部处于活塞的内流通阀孔的正下方,在所述复原阀弹簧座的顶面设有复原阀节流阀片和调整垫片,所述调整垫片处于复位阀节流阀片与复原阀弹簧座之间,在所述间隔套的顶面与活塞的底面之间设有密封垫圈,所述密封垫圈处于内流通阀孔的阀壁底面与间隔套的顶面之间,所述复原阀节流阀片的顶面处于内流通阀孔与外流通阀孔之间的阀壁底面上,还设有活塞螺母,所述活塞螺母处于间隔套的正下方,在所述活塞螺母与所述复原阀弹簧座之间固定有复原阀弹簧。在所述复原弹簧座的顶面与调整垫片的底面之间固定有橡胶密封圈。在所述流通阀限位垫内设有底面开口的凹腔,所述流通阀弹簧片为倒V字形设置,所述流通阀弹簧片的顶角处于凹腔内且两端向下伸出凹腔。在所述活塞的外侧均匀设有U形凹槽,在所述活塞的外壁上设有密封抵圈,在所述密封抵圈的内壁上设有与所述U形凹槽相配合的U形 ...
